An introverted AI coder struggling to keep her grandfather's theater and her mother's legacy from being destroyed, decides to use her skills to blur the line between fiction and reality — and in the process, opens a door into the magic that is cinema.

Directed by Yolanda Torres · Written by Yolanda Torres
